I started my design career in the housewares industry at Casabella and Bradshaw Home before shifting into the clean beauty & hair space at Susteau and a toy designer at Clixo. Though I began in industrial design, my focus as a designer has expanded throughout my career. To date it includes launching physical products on the market, creating packaging for product lineups, running brand social media, building out pitch decks and branding for successfully funded startups, and leading a small design team.

As an industrial designer at Clixo toys I’ve developed new products, product lines, expansion packs, educational sets and packaging for retail and education. With a focus on extensive prototyping, testing, sketching, 3D modeling and 3D printing Clixo has a fast paced startup mentality that always keeps things moving. The small design team is very collaborative while still enabling each designer to own their own projects.

At Susteau, we delivered science-backed waterless formula products that are less wasteful and more sustainable, while not compromising performance. As the Head of Design, I developed the most eco-conscious primary and secondary packaging solutions feasible. Each bottle is made of at least 95% post-consumer, ocean-bound plastic. Not only is the material more sustainable, Susteau’s best-selling Hair Wash is delivered in a smaller bottle and lasts up to 4X as long as a traditional 8oz liquid shampoo.

As a housewares industrial designer at Casabella I was a part of a team of in-house designers creating new, redesigned and concept products. We conducted deep dive market research, sketched, prototyped and made countless models, before finalizing our design with 3D modeling, renders and sample production. We worked with factories directly to approve fit, finish and final production. I launched several products for major housewares retailers including Target, Bed Bath & Beyond, Whole Foods, TJ Maxx/ Homegoods, Container Store, Amazon and more. My final project was creating an entire line of kitchen and home cleaning tools that had replaceable heads made from recycled plastic and sustainably sourced wood handles that’s on the market today.
